The Simplicity 35 is our most popular system due to its durability, versatility, and unlimited length.
It is completely constructed from aluminium, giving you a structure with unbeatable durability together with a life expectancy of up to 60 years. This robust system is also supplied with a full 10 year guarantee.
The Simplicity 35 can be manufactured to any length to meet specific requirements and can span up to 6 metres, enabling you to cover multiple cars easily with minimum posts for use as a carport or creating a large entertaining or resting area as a Garden Patio Veranda or Glass Room.
It has a modern, stylish appearance and benefits from robust integral aluminium guttering which creates an attractive finish to the structure whilst also ensuring a quick installation. Furthermore, this aluminium guttering requires minimal subsequent maintenance throughout the product’s lifetime.
The Simplicity 35 system features 35mm structured polycarbonate roof panels, which are available in Clear, Opal, Bronze and Heatshield and offers in excess of 98% UV protection which reduces the risk of your vehicle paintwork fading if used as a carport plus the added benefit of protecting you and your family from the harmful sun rays.
They can also keep the interior of your vehicles or adjoining rooms cool by creating shade and shelter, preventing unwanted heat on hot, sunny days.
The Simplicity 35 has a variable wall pitch from 2.5° – 45° so that you can decide on the height of the wall-plate to suit your needs – ideal for taller vehicles such as campervans and caravans.
The aluminium framework is supplied in Anthracite Grey Textured (RAL 7016) as standard.

Why Sell The Simplicity 35 System To Your Customers?
- Full 10 Year Guarantee and a 60 year life expectancy
- Fully Aluminium System – Including heavy duty structural aluminium roof bars for ultimate strength
- Stainless Steel Fixings – All of the fixings are 316 marine grade stainless steel for longevity and total resistance to corrosion
- Integral Aluminium Guttering – Saves time on installation and creates a robust and attractive gutter system
- 35mm Structured Polycarbonate with block edge finish – A block edge finish features a hard edge on both sides of the panel, which provides a much stronger roof system for improved snow loading capabilities
- Fire Performance – Our polycarbonate panels benefit from excellent fire performance, meeting BS476 part 7 class 1, EN13501 and B-s1, d0
- Robust Roof System – The roofing system is strong enough to be walked on as a means of escape and maintenance, with the use of boards
- Variable Roof Pitch – The roof has a variable pitch of between 2.5° – 45°
- High UV Protection – A layer of UV absorber is coextruded on the outer surface of the roof panels which prevents damaging UV radiation from penetrating the sheet and protects those underneath from the sun. UV protection also prevents yellowing and loss of strength to the panel, giving it longer life
- Colour Options – The Simplicity 35 can be coloured to any of our standard options: Anthracite Grey Textured (RAL 7016).
- Large Projection – Projection of up to 6 metres to create large shaded areas if required
- Unlimited Length – This structure can be constructed to any length to suit requirements

System Specs |
|
---|---|
Max Projection: | 6.0m |
Max Span Between Posts: | 3.5m |
Minimum Pitch: | 2.5 degrees |
Maximum Pitch: | 45 degrees |
Roof Panel Type: | 35mm poly |
Max Gap Between Roof Bars: | Polycarbonate width (up to 4m projection) is a maximum of 1250mm wide. Minimum to be as close to 1250 as the width will allow. When over 4m make centres 1000mm up to 4.5m and then reduce to 600mm up to 5m and 500mm over that to 6m maximum projection. |
Lighting Option: | LED Strip Lighting |
Upgrades Available: | Lighting, Heaters |
Colour: | RAL 7016 Anthracite Grey Textured |
Drainage: | External |
Warranty: | 10 years with expected lifespan of 60 years |
